Common Tech Support Issues and How to Solve Them
Many people frequently face frequent tech issues that can be quite upsetting. A popular one involves trouble connecting to the network; often, refreshing your router and machine can clear the problem . Another usual challenge is a slow computer , which might be fixed by removing unnecessary documents and performing a hard drive cleanup. Finally , forgetting your copyright is a surprisingly reported problem , usually solved by using the “ can't remember credentials” option on the platform .
Tech Support Scams: What to Watch Out For
Be extremely cautious of surprise phone rings or window alerts claiming your system has a problem . These are common tactics used by scammers in tech support schemes . They might demand immediate control to your computer or urge you purchase costly software . Never share personal data or banking information to anyone you don't trust. Legitimate firms rarely initiate tech support outreach in this way.
Proactive Tech Support: Preventing Problems Before They Happen
Rather than reacting to issues, modern tech support is moving towards a preventative approach. This system involves regularly monitoring networks for potential malfunctions and resolving risks before they disrupt business. By using software and best practices, tech teams can find and mitigate issues, decreasing downtime and boosting overall efficiency.
The Guide to Successful Tech Service Dialogue
To ensure a pleasant fix to your technical difficulties, precise dialogue with tech assistance is critical. Begin by clearly explaining your problem, specifying all pertinent details like the system model, the software you're using, and any fault messages you've encountered. Avoid using industry terms unless you’re positive the support person knows it. Lastly, stay calm and understanding, even if it feels difficult; their objective is to assist your problem.
